1.加减乘除
add 加
subtract 减
multiply 乘
divide 除
2. 数组
创建数组
BigDecimal[] bigDecimals = new BigDecimal[]{BigDecimal.ZERO,BigDecimal.ZERO};
如果默认这么创建:
BigDecimal[] bigDecimals = new BigDecimal[];
那么其实他的数组都是null,就像下面这样,在赋值的时候就可能会报错
BigDecimal[] bigDecimals = new BigDecimal[]{null,null};
所以BigDeciBigDecimal.ZERO的作用就是赋值为0的bigdecimal
3.取余
setScale
本文介绍了Java中的基本算术操作,如加减乘除,并详细讲解了BigDecimal数组的创建和初始化。默认创建的BigDecimal数组元素为null,可能导致运行时错误,因此推荐使用BigDecimal.ZERO初始化以避免空值问题。同时,还提到了取余运算和setScale方法在数值计算中的应用。
12万+

被折叠的 条评论
为什么被折叠?



